So Real

Listen to poem:
I dreamt that dream again it seemed so real and yet surreal It always was very dark I was near a cliff as waves crashed and crashed against the wall over and over again Nothing ever happened in my dream I was only nine still I wondered if it might mean something till one day it came to me… Mommy, I keep dreaming of when I was in your tummy I had somehow realized in my dreamworld I had found a way to cope with all the stressful changes in my little life being uprooted a significant move a new school It was my soul’s version of rocking my little body and reassuring me everything would be alright I had figured it out then never had the dream again AP: 1st place 2020 Posted in March 25, 2018
